What Is a Pipe Elbow?

An elbow is a kind of pipe fitting introduced between two pipes predominantly to alter the course of direction. These butt weld pipe elbows are ordinarily accessible in 90°, 60°, and 45° edges. Be that as it may, these days, there are numerous different degrees of elbows accessible.

Decreasing elbow, otherwise called reducer elbow, is a sure sort when both the closures of elbow varies in sizes. This is regularly used to associate two distinct sizes of pipe with a noteworthy turn.

Types of pipe elbows

1) ANSI/ASME B16.9 90° Long Radius Elbow

ANSI/ASME B16.9 90° Long Radius Elbow is installed between two lengths of tubing (or pipe) to allow a change of direction at 90° angle. Long radius elbow is primarily used to connect hoses to valves, water pumps and deck drains.

2) ANSI/ASME B16.9 90° Short Radius Elbow

The radius of curvature of ANSI/ASME B16.9 90° Short-radius (LR) elbow is 1.0 times the pipe diameter. The short radius elbows are used where there is scarcity of space.

3) ANSI/ASME B16.9 45° Long Radius Elbow

ANSI/ASME B16.9 45° Long Radius Elbow is installed between two lengths of tubing (or pipe) to allow a change of direction at 45° angle. Long radius elbows give less frictional resistance to the fluid & create lesser pressure drop than short radius elbows.

4) ANSI/ASME B16.9 45° short Radius Elbow

A 45º short radius elbow is mainly attached to plastic, copper, cast iron, steel, lead, and can also be attached to rubber with stainless-steel clamps . A 45º elbow used in water-supply facilities, food, chemical and electronic industrial pipeline networks, air-conditioning pipelines, agriculture and garden production, and solar-energy facility piping.

5) ANSI/ASME B16.9 180° Short Radius Elbow

ANSI/ASME B16.9 180° Short Radius Elbow is installed between two lengths of tubing (or pipe) to allow a change of direction at 180° angle. The radius of curvature of ANSI/ASME B16.9 180° Short-radius (LR) elbow is 1.0 times the pipe diameter.

6) ANSI/ASME B16.9 180° Long Radius Elbow

ANSI/ASME B16.9 180° Long Radius Elbow is installed between two lengths of tubing (or pipe) to allow a change of direction at 180° angle. The radius of curvature of ANSI/ASME B16.9 180° long-radius (LR) elbow is 1.5 times the pipe diameter and is used in low-pressure gravity-fed systems and other applications where low turbulence and minimum deposition of entrained solids are of primary concern.
